Russian Federation Finance and Banking
The Central Bank of Russia refinancing rate has been reduced to 24%. The interest rate determines a number of important items for tax purposes, including the maximum interest deduction for profits tax purposes for rouble loans.

Revaluation of fixed assets

In accordance with clarifications of the State Tax Service and of the Ministry of Finance the results of revaluation of fixed assets as of 1 January 1997 are not to be used in calculation of property tax and depreciation in 1997. The revaluation as at 1 January 1997 is to be performed in the course of 1997 and is to effect the balance sheet of the taxpayer for the first quarter of 1998.

Letter of State Tax Service of 25 March 1997 no. SSH-4-02/12n
"On the property tax on enterprises"

Relaxation of GKO rules

The CBR increased the number of allowed operations with GKOs, and in particular, it is now allowed to pledge GKOs not only to the Central Bank but to the other parties. GKOs can be transferred to and from dealers depository accounts as a result of pledge operations.

Order of the Central Bank no. 02-225 of 21 May 1997

Joint tax audits with the Ukraine

"Argumenty i Facty Agency" has reported that the Russian State Tax Service and the State Tax Agency of the Ukraine agreed to carry out joint tax audits of legal entities acting on the territory of both states. This has been announced by the Information Department of the State Tax Service after the inter-governmental agreement between Russia and the Ukraine was signed on 28 May 1997.
